What is the process to apply for a student visa in Spain as a Guatemalan?
Guatemalans who wish to study in Spain must apply for a student visa. The process includes obtaining an admission letter from a Spanish educational institution, submitting the application to the Spanish consulate in Guatemala, and meeting financial and health insurance requirements.
How is risk assessment carried out under AML regulations in Costa Rica?
Risk assessment in Costa Rica involves reviewing factors such as the nature of the relationship, geographic location, client's occupation, source of funds, and exposure to high-risk activities. This helps determine the level of risk associated with the client and allows financial institutions to apply due diligence measures proportional to the risk.
What is the process for annulling a marriage in the Dominican Republic for reasons of error?
Annulling a marriage in the Dominican Republic for reasons of error involves filing a lawsuit in court and proving that one or both spouses were married due to a substantial error that affects the validity of the marriage.
